VPS虚拟专用服务器通过虚拟化技术将物理服务器划分为多个独立环境,用户可获得类似独立服务器的资源控制权。其核心优势在于成本低、灵活性高,支持按需配置CPU、内存和存储,适合搭建网站、测试环境或运行轻量级应用。用户可通过SSH或RDP远程管理,无需硬件投入即可快速部署服务。
一、vps虚拟机怎么用?
登录控制面板
使用VPS提供商提供的用户名和密码登录其控制面板,这是管理虚拟机的核心入口。
创建虚拟机
选择操作系统:根据需求选择Linux或Windows系统。
配置资源:分配CPU核心数、内存大小、硬盘空间及带宽。
高级设置:可启用虚拟化支持或调整网络模式。
安装系统与远程管理工具
Linux系统:通过SSH客户端连接,使用命令行安装软件。
Windows系统:通过远程桌面协议(RDP)连接,使用图形界面安装软件。
推荐工具:
文件传输:FileZilla(SFTP/FTP)、WinSCP
监控:htop(Linux)、Task Manager(Windows)
备份:Duplicati、Rclone
网络与安全配置
防火墙规则:开放必要端口,关闭高危端口。
SSH密钥登录:生成密钥对,将公钥上传至VPS,禁用密码登录以增强安全性。
VPN配置:若需隐藏IP,可搭建OpenVPN或WireGuard服务。
环境部署与应用运行
网站托管:安装LAMP/LEMP栈,部署WordPress等CMS。
游戏服务器:安装SteamCMD,配置端口转发和防火墙规则。
开发测试:使用Docker容器化应用,或搭建Kubernetes集群。
二、VPS连接方法详解
连接VPS的通用步骤
获取连接信息:从VPS提供商处获取IP地址、端口号、用户名及密码或密钥文件。
选择连接方式:
Linux/Mac系统:使用终端或SSH客户端执行命令 ssh 用户名@IP地址 -p 端口号。
Windows系统:
SSH连接:使用PuTTY或Windows 10内置OpenSSH,输入IP和端口后验证身份。
RDP连接:通过“远程桌面连接”应用输入IP和凭据。
文件传输:使用FileZilla等FTP/SFTP客户端,选择SFTP协议并输入服务器信息。
特殊设备连接方法
Chromebook:安装Secure Shell或Termius等SSH客户端应用,输入VPS的IP和凭据。
三、常见问题与解决方案
连接超时/失败
检查网络:确保本地网络正常,尝试更换网络环境。
防火墙规则:确认VPS防火墙和本地防火墙未阻止端口。
安全组设置:云服务商需在安全组中放行对应端口。
认证失败
密码错误:通过控制面板重置密码,或使用密钥登录。
SSH服务未运行:登录控制面板重启SSH服务。
密钥权限问题:确保私钥文件权限为600。
性能不足
资源监控:使用top(Linux)或任务管理器(Windows)查看CPU/内存占用。
优化配置:关闭不必要的服务,调整Nginx工作进程数。
升级套餐:若长期高负载,建议升级至更高配置的VPS。
四、进阶技巧
自动化管理
使用Ansible或Shell脚本批量部署软件。
配置Cron定时任务。
多VPS协同
通过SSH隧道转发端口。
使用WireGuard搭建内网,实现VPS间高速通信。
成本优化
选择按流量计费的VPS降低闲置成本。
使用Spot实例处理非关键任务,成本可降低70%-90%。
vps虚拟机连接前需确保端口开放,并配置防火墙规则。为提升安全性,建议禁用密码登录,改用SSH密钥认证,并定期更新系统补丁。通过控制面板可实现一键重启、重装系统等操作,适合新手快速上手。